About Nicole LeeAnn
Nicole LeeAnn Barrett built a steady path into the Missouri bar, blending classroom rigor with steady practice. She earned a Bachelor of Science from Missouri State University in 2002 and a Juris Doctor from the University of Missouri–Columbia in 2005. Those years shaped the technical and analytical habits that have guided her work since.
After law school Barrett entered practice in Missouri. She was admitted to practice in the state and has spent her career serving local clients.
